Every experienced litigator has been in the situation of winning a case and nevertheless facing an unhappy client. More often than not, at the end of a lawsuit, neither side is happy with the outcome. As a general rule in this country, attorneys’ fees are not recoverable by the prevailing party. Thus, after taking into consideration attorneys’ fees and other costs of litigation, the party making the claim often believes he received less than a full recovery, … Read the rest
